What are the statistics of school uniforms?

According to the National Center for Education Statistics, nearly 20% of all public schools have adopted uniform mandates. Approximately 22% of elementary schools, 19% of all middle schools, and 10% of high schools currently require uniforms, and this trend continues to accelerate.

Do school uniforms make you smarter?

According to a new study by researchers at the University of Houston, school uniforms seem to be decently effective at improving student attendance and teacher retention, but have no real impact on improving student achievement.

How much do school uniforms cost on average?

Typical costs: A general uniform of standardized clothing can cost $25-$200 per outfit or about $100-$600 for a school wardrobe (four or five mix-and-match outfits), depending on the quality and number of the pieces, the retailer and the location.

Are uniforms cheaper than regular clothes?

While uniforms may be cheaper than non-uniform outfits, they are also an entirely unnecessary and additional expense. Families don’t buy uniforms instead of street clothes (because the child needs something to wear when it is isn’t at school), they buy them as well as street clothes.
